[kvm-unit-tests PATCH 07/17] arm: gic: Extend check_acked() to allow silent call

For future tests we will need to call check_acked() twice for the same
interrupt (to test delivery of Group 0 and Group 1 interrupts).
This should be reported as a single test, so allow check_acked() to be
called with a "NULL" test name, to suppress output. We report the test
result via the return value, so the outcome is not lost.

Also this amends the new trigger_and_check_spi() wrapper, to propagate
the test result to callers of that function.
